    Phoneme Segmentation War

    Grade Level: 2nd 3rd

    Purpose:

    Segmenting phonemes in a word can be very difficult for students, especially when it comes to

    identifying every phoneme that is present. Learning segmentation however, is important for

    developing reading skills within each student. When a student segments a word they are

    identifying the words individual sounds, which helps the student to understand letter sound

    relationships in the future. Segmentation is also beneficial for learning how to decode words

    based on their sounds, and chunking words through phonemes that they already know.

    Description:

    Segmentation War is similar to its card game counterpart. " pair of students will separate the

    card deck into half and flip over a card at the same time. $ach student will then count the number

    of phonemes in their picture% the student whose picture has the most number of phonemes takes

    both cards. &or e'ample, ob flips over a picture of a pig, he counts his phonemes )p) )i) )g) * +and Suy flips over a picture of a tiger )t) )i) )g) )er) *-. Since Suy has a higher number of

    phonemes she takes both cards. he students continue to play until they are out of cards.

    f there is a disagreement between the two students over who has more phonemes or whether or

    not one person is correct they can check the answer binder. he binder will contain the number

    of phonemes for every picture in the card game.

    f a student wants to play this game individually they can sort the cards by the number of

    phonemes each picture has.
